drugs, PSA 

BTW, @aschmitz added some wonderful advice onto this that I highly recommend you read. I'd just like to add two more things myself:
1) Not only is injectable naloxone cheaper, but intramuscular injection is generally more effective, so if you're comfortable with IM injections, that's definitely the preferred route.
2) If you ever administer naloxone, you need to get that person into a hospital or otherwise transfer them to emergency care (say, EMTs). It's not a substitute for that.

re: drugs, PSA 

@auravulpes Oh! Also. When you use naloxone, you're bringing someone off a high *really* fast, and they're not likely to be thrilled. Ideally it doesn't happen but people have been known to lash out even if they wouldn't normally, so be prepared and stay safe.

Finally, the instructions say this but it's worth repeating: if someone overdosed and was unresponsive, you should bring them to the hospital *anyway*: naloxone can wear off faster than opioids, so they're not out of danger.

re: drugs, PSA 

@auravulpes Additional useful things:

* If you are comfortable around needles, injectable generic naloxone is way, way cheaper than the name brand spray.

* Read the instructions! They're not hard, but it's the sort of thing you want to at least mentally think through using before you need it.

* Depending on your location, there may be a place that gives out kits for free, especially if you're likely to need it. Search for "free naloxone [city]".

drugs, PSA 

Hey, did you know you can just *get* naloxone? Yeah! In the US, you can just go into pharmacies in most (all?) states and ask for naloxone and get it. There's even a nice piece of paper to help you get NARCAN, a nasal spray version: narcan.com/static/NARCAN-Presc

Naloxone is *really* useful to have around, especially if you or someone you care for have opioids, as it can reverse the effects of overdose long enough for EMTs to get on scene. Definitely worth having around, just in case.
